Clarity linked to a rumor and gossip
Some social media activists have been spreading rumors and fake news for two days that the orphanage's authorities were allegedly pulled out a kidney of an orphan which disturbed the minds of our countrymen and citizens. For the evaluation, clarification, and truth-finding of this case, Leadership of the Ministry of Labor and Social Affairs has tasked and ordered a fact-finding commission to this assumption. During the evaluation of the Board, it became clear That Mohammad Ali, son of Sajjad Ali, A sixth-class student at the orphanage of Tahya-e-Maskan suffered a kidney disease in 2016. Orphanage officials of the Ministry of Labor and Social Affairs then signed an agreement with the Emergency Hospital for his treatment. After that, he was transferred there and the baby was under treatment by an Italian doctor for about six months constantly. According to the Emergency Hospital Report, The baby's kidney had stones and inflammation, finally after diagnose and kidney operation, his treatment has been completed and his health was improved. To clarify public opinions and minds, the Ministry of Labor and Social Affairs has tested the baby at Blossom Hospital today August 21, 2019. The result of the experiment shows that miraculously, shows that both kidneys are available and exist. For more clarifications, evidence of Photos and tested documents were also shared here. It is mentionable that all respected media can obtain child treatment records at the Emergency Hospital and their new tests from the Ministry of Labor and Social Affairs and the Blossom and Emergency Hospitals.
